ya, that\'d be nice, but how about each town has a set of rules for their type of culture, such as if a town was based off of friendly folk who hate fighting, then if u have ur weapon out then ur gonna get arrested

but lets say if i went to a town without this rule cause it was based off of neutral or war-like ppl, then maybe someone would come up (depending on lvl and stats) and challenge you to a duel, some harmless others to the death, and u wont get sent to prison by carrying a weapon, but there should be more guards cause with weapons showing is bound to be thieves lurking around to takem (even if it wasnt the one on hand)

but maybe there should be a couple of towns there they only like certain ppl with certain types of weapons, such as if u have equiped a sword or another melee weapon, and walk into town ur tagged as a melee user in that town, and so if they LIKE melee users they\'ll welcome u, otherwhyys they\'d despise u and make things more expensive and give u rude responses

i.e.: a magic user walks into town with his magic staff equiped, the town favors magic users, and so he goes to the nearest inn for a quick rest, the cost was reduced abit more then in normal towns, then the magic user goes to the nearest magic shop to buy a new staff/wand/orb/ect., they\'re sold abit more expensive but are much better then what are at a normal town\'s magic shop

i.e.2: a melee user walks into a town with his sword equiped, the town favors range users, and this char goes to the inn and is charged more then a normal town inn would charge, he then goes to the nearest blacksmith, all the weapons are much more expensive and are mainly comprised of ranged weapons, with 1-3 melee weapons for the other ppl, this char walks out and goes to a magic shop to see if they have healing pots, them and a magic user\'s weapon is charged much higher then normal

as u can tell this could be VERY handy for finding better things then other towns but having to travel through tough-easy environments depending on lvl (usualy made for the higher up ppl) but even so a melee/range/magic based town has more things for the type of character they favor then the others

and once u enter a town (close enough for the guards to identify u like a monster) you are considered a type of character from whatever u got equiped (out or not), if u havnt got anything equiped, ur favored as melee because of fist fights, if u switch weapons while in town to get things cheaper, it wouldnt work, until u made a new character and had him/her go there

NOTE: if u go into a range based town with a bow and ur melee just to get a weapon u see, all magic/melee based weapons will not be sold TO you because they assume u dont favor those type of weapons

For keyword triggered attack I think it would probably only be possible if you said something you\'re not supposed to, or if you know something you\'re not supposed to.


Lets assume basilisk eggs are illegal to own/buy/make etc.
PC:hello
NPC wizard tower gaurd: move along, I have no time for small talk with citizens
PC: where do you keep the basilisk\'s eggs?
(the NPC may outright confront you, or quietly summon -using NPC telepathy;)- a couple gaurds to drag you away and question you)

Situations like this could probably be avoided by using common sense. If you went up to a cop and starting asking where you could buy drugs, you\'d probably be in a bit of trouble.
